How to Program a Key

The majority of new keys for modern cars have to be programmed to function. This can be accomplished at a dealer's parts department or by a locksmith equipped with the right tools.

There are two scenarios in which the programming of keys is needed in the shop: adding an extra key or the working keys are lost. The steps for each vary slightly however they can be broken into the following categories:

Chips

The transponder is a small chip that is included in many car keys today. When you insert your key into the ignition lock and turn the key to ON, the antenna transmits the radio frequency signal to the transponder with the identification code. The chip then transmits an energy burst, which the ignition lock utilizes to determine whether the key is the right one to open the car.

If your vehicle is set to only accept a specific type of chip, it will not start with a non-transponder car key programming cost key. This is a way of stopping car theft since the only person who can start your vehicle with keys stolen is the original owner. If you're a professional locksmith or auto repair technician key fob programming tools offer convenience as well as cost savings and peace of mind for your customers. These tools are usually bidirectional OBD-II devices that connect to the computer of a vehicle in order to extract the data needed to program. These tools can program a range of different vehicle makes and models, and some even offer additional diagnostic functions.

The most frequent use of key programmer is to copy a working car key cut and program key. This can be done by connecting the device to a working key, then inserting it into the ignition, and then turning the key on until the security light blinks. This will activate the key and make it work just like the original.

When you use a mobile key programming programmer there are a few things to keep in mind. You should be aware that if you fail to follow the instructions correctly, you could damage the immobilizer system of your vehicle. Also, make sure that the tool you are using is compatible with your car and its immobilizer system.
